Job Responsibilities
The role involves performing administrative tasks and providing high-quality service to students, principals, teachers, and other staff at the school. You will work primarily in Gothenburg City's student administrative system IST Administration, as well as Skola24 and Vklass.
Responsibilities include, for example, student registration and deregistration, changing course groups, schedule adjustments, file management, grade handling, CSN (Student Aid) reporting, ordering national tests, managing Västtrafik travel cards, and releasing public documents. This means you will work across several different digital platforms.
The role also includes staffing the school reception, which is a natural place to meet students with their daily questions. Other reception duties include serving staff, welcoming and receiving visitors, and answering the reception phone. You will also serve as our external contact for guardians and authorities such as CSN and other schools.
The role of Student Administrator is a central and important position in the school's daily operations, where many new situations can arise during the workday. This involves a variety of tasks that depend on both the time of the school year and what is happening on any given day. It requires you to be flexible, a quick learner, and unpretentious.
The role may also include tasks such as marketing, and leading or participating in activities and projects with students and other staff.
You will work together with the current Student Administrator in a team.

Other Information
For your interview, you must bring a passport/national ID and, if you hold citizenship outside the EU/EEA, proof of residence permit. As an employer, we need to verify your identity and ensure you have the right to work in Sweden.
In accordance with laws regulating register checks, anyone offered this position must provide an extract from the criminal record register before an employment contract can be drawn up.
For positions requiring specific education, candidates who proceed in the recruitment process will be asked to submit documentation proving their education, e.g., licenses or diplomas. You can also attach them directly to your application.
